AT&T - Leading with Distinction
After a series of joint ventures and acquisitions, AT&T had assembled a wide array of assets. The objective of the senior leadership team was no longer about acquisitions for scale and transformation; it was now about executing on the combined set of assets. AT&T needed to break down silos, change its culture to incorporate more innovative and collaborative thinking, and focus on the complexities and trade-off s in executing on it's the 3-year plan. The company also needed to foster a "One AT&T" mindset, and develop a market leader mentality, as one of the largest integrated communications company on the planet.
Solution - An Experience Enabling Leaders to Practice Successful Execution of AT&T’s 3-year Plan:
A cascading strategic initiative comprised of 5-day, 3-day and 2-day workshops with online pre-work and post-session follow-up. The solution, “LEADING with DISTINCTION” (LwD), is a world-class leadership and strategic alignment initiative custom-designed for AT&T. The program combines experiential learning, Officer and Senior Manager led discussions, subject matter experts, and peer networking, to focus on the following key areas of development:
- Alignment with the one AT&T strategic direction
- Global strategic perspective
- Leading change and innovation
- Collaboration and employee engagement
- Cultural transformation
- Financial and business acumen
The interactive, discovery-based online pre-work served to level set participants on AT&T’s key financial and operational terminology, as well as strategic imperatives and macroeconomic and industry trends.
Business Outcomes: Team-based Approach Focused on Collaboration, Innovation & Extraordinary Leadership

Participants in each workshop collaborate in teams, which vie with each other for customers and talent in a dynamically competitive marketplace. Teams must execute on AT&T’s strategy while focusing on success factors in AT&T’s Extraordinary Leadership model, a strength-based approach to leadership development.
As the first step, teams devise their 3-year plan for successful execution of AT&T’s business plan, including an articulation of the culture required for success. This strategic road-map includes measurable goals on AT&T’s primary business metrics, prioritization of AT&T’s key strategic imperatives, and alignment of capabilities across business units and functional areas.
Successful execution requires leaders on each team to work collaboratively across functions to maximize their competitiveness in the market. Teams discover that it is critical to break down silos if they are to drive profit table growth for One AT&T. In addition, leaders are encouraged to take a long term view involving calculated risks. The teams who are able to see and seize new opportunities achieve competitive advantages and superior results.
The experience aligns participants to AT&T’s strategic direction and objectives, and enables them to develop and practice leadership skills that will support successful execution of the company’s plans, including leading change.
Each participating leader committed to a personal action plan, drawing line of sight from the company’s strategic objectives to their day-to-day work. These plans focused on concrete actions leaders would take to lead with distinction and accelerate execution of AT&T’s strategic imperatives. In addition to providing a monetary profit improvement estimate, leaders outlined how their plan served to improve Return on Invested Capital, a long-term measure for the company. To date, participants have targeted hundreds of millions of dollars of improvements aligned to the One AT&T strategy. Moreover, the initiative has been credited with accelerating the formation of new work groups and organization changes to support the strategy.
The initiative also included a feedback mechanism to senior management, whereby participants were provided with an opportunity to engage with senior AT&T executives. During these dialogues, participants discussed key challenges and barriers for AT&T.
